Yes and no. Absolute JND (just noticieable difference) is around 3 cents 
last I recall. That means two pitches played after each other will sound 
equal if the pitch doesn't differ more than that. However, for pitches 
played together, it's much much less due to the beating. This becomes an 
issue when you detune the voices with the CV dac to, say, one octave 
difference.
